MASHPEE FINANCE COMMITTEE MEETING MINUTES <br /> OCTOBER 5, 1993 <br /> MEETING COMMENCED AT 7:OOPM <br /> Members Present: Dan Goggin, Chairman; Deirdre Greelish; Denise <br /> Sullivan and Marcia King. <br /> Please note for the record that the Minutes of August 17, 1993 have <br /> not been approved. <br /> Please also note for the record that the taping of this meeting was <br /> for the transcription of the Minutes only. The tapes will be <br /> reused once the Minutes are approved. <br /> MINUTES <br /> Deirdre Greelish Motioned to accept the Minutes of September 21, <br /> 1993 as written. Marcia King seconded the Motion and members voted <br /> 3-0. Dan Goggin abstaining. <br /> Dan Goggin dictated a letter for J. Vaccaro thanking him for <br /> keeping the Finance Committee informed in regards to the recently <br /> settled contracts. Mr. Goggin asked that any future collective <br /> bargaining sessions or strategy sessions regarding the Police or <br /> Fire Union Contracts be made known to the Finance Committee for <br /> their presence. <br /> Mr. Goggin also felt that it would still be the position of the <br /> Finance Committee to disagree with any money articles in the <br /> October Town Warrant, with few exceptions. <br /> Mr. Goggin suggested adding 2 1/2% to last years revenues to <br /> approximate this years revenues. <br /> Mr. Goggin suggested that the Fiscal Policy Report be updated. Ms. <br /> Greelish felt that this was a great idea also. Mr. Goggin thought <br /> it would be helpful to do projections for 4 or 5 years. The <br /> Finance Committee could work with the Departments directly. Mr. <br /> Goggin suggested to the members present that they review the Fiscal <br /> Policy Report. <br /> Mr. Goggin felt that at the next meeting, the Committee should <br /> discuss the new liaison assignments. He also stated that the <br /> Finance Committee, if acceptable to all members, would meet on the <br /> first and third Tuesdays of each month. <br /> Dan also felt it would be helpful to the town if the Finance <br /> Committee could print out an FY93 Budget vs. Actual FY93 Budget and <br /> use a variance column. <br />
